MUMBAI: Ramona D���Souza, a partner of PN Writer & Co, has moved the Bombay High Court alleging that her brothers Willaim and Denzil D���Souza, also partners of the firm, had fraudulently transferred the assets of the company to a private firm, Writer Corporation. William (deceased) and Denzil had formed Writer Corporation in which Ramona is not a partner.

She has asked for an injunction so that her brothers could not transfer their rights in Writer Corporation to a third party. The High Court has denied her an interim relief. Justice Anand Nirgude has observed that ���the case of the plaintiff (Ramona) that she was unaware of these transfers is rather difficult to believe.���

Justice Nirgude held that a previous Bombay High Court order restrained the company from disposing of and transferring the assets or destroying any accounts. This should eliminate Ramona���s fear that her brothers would transfer their rights to a third party, the court observed adding there was no need for any further interim relief in the matter.

Earlier, Ramona had moved the court alleging that her brothers were siphoning off funds from the company, which is engaged in removing, clearing, forwarding, shipping, packing and storage businesses. The court had then restrained PN Writer & Co from transferring its assets or destroying any accounts and records. The court had also directed Denzil to pay Ramona a sum of Rs 50,000 per month.

When Denzil had challenged the order in the Supreme Court, the apex court had confirmed the high court order and had appointed retired Justice SP Bharucha as the arbitrator to settle the dispute. The arbitration proceedings are pending.
